Art3d self-adhesive vinyl floor transition strip (10 ft, 1.57in) for laminate, tiles & carpet edges
Product description
If you’re trying to tidy up the join between two floor surfaces, a transition strip sounds like a small detail. But on the ground (literally), it’s the difference between something that looks planned and something that catches the eye and traps dirt.
This Art3d self-adhesive vinyl floor transition strip is designed to cover floor gaps where two surfaces meet. It’s also aimed at threshold-style transitions, including edging around carpet. It’s not a magic wand for uneven floors—this one is for flat, clean, dry surfaces where a peel-and-stick approach can actually grip.
The essentials
The strip is made from PVC and is positioned for daily wear: it’s described as scratch resistant, abrasion resistant and stain resistant. The practicality here is that you shouldn’t need specialist cleaning either—just wipe it with a damp cloth.

Installation is intentionally straightforward: peel and stick to a flat and dry floor, then cut with scissors before fitting. The adhesive is a strong tape type, so the prep matters. Art3d also notes that the strip can be compressed or bent during transport, and that using a hair dryer can help restore the bond.
What it’s for (and where it fits best)
Where this strip makes the most sense is at transitions in the areas you use all the time—bedrooms, living rooms, kitchens and showers are called out in the description. The strip is also presented as a separator in transition zones, such as the area between a living room and a kitchen.


A simple way to think about it: if you have a visible gap at the meeting point of two floor types, this strip is meant to visually cover that join and provide a smoother edge.

Key takeaways (what you’ll notice in use)
On paper, the combination of PVC build plus the stated resistance to scratches, abrasion and stains should suit household traffic. If you’re dealing with a threshold transition or a gap you’d rather not constantly clean around, having a defined edge can make daily upkeep easier.
That said, it’s not designed to solve deeper issues like lifting tiles, major height differences, or a subfloor that isn’t flat. Self-adhesive strips tend to look best when the floor is properly prepared and the join is reasonably straight.
Also, take note of the “clean and dry (water free)” reminder before installation. If moisture is present, it may compromise adhesion.

Installation, but with the gotchas
The process is simple: cut to length with scissors, then stick to a flat and dry floor. The description is clear that you should make sure the floor is clean and dry to ensure optimal use.


There’s one more practical limitation worth flagging: because the strip can be compressed or bent during transport, it may not sit perfectly flat immediately. Art3d suggests using a hair dryer to restore the bond and improve the adhesive effect. That’s a small extra step, but it can be the difference between “stuck down first go” and “needs a bit of patience”.
Tech specs

- Name: Art3d Self Adhesive Vinyl Floor Transition Strip
- Type: Self-adhesive vinyl floor transition / flat divider strip
- Material: PVC (vinyl)
- Colour: Black
- Format: Floor transition strip
- Size: 10 FT (300cm) length, 1.57in (4cm) width, 0.3cm thickness
